The Navegante Pass is the monthly pass used across the Lisbon Metropolitan Area (AML), ideal for residents, workers and students who use public transport regularly.

1. Main types of Navegante Pass
Navegante Municipal
- Valid within a single municipality (Lisbon, Sintra, Cascais, Oeiras, etc.)
- Ideal for residents who commute only inside one council
- Reference price: around €30
Navegante Metropolitano
- Valid across all 18 municipalities of the AML
- Perfect for cross–municipality commuting
- Reference price: around €40
Prices may change annually — always confirm on official sites.
2. Personalised Navegante card
To load a Navegante Pass you need a personalised card with your name and photo.
3. Discount profiles
- 4_18 — children and students up to 18
- sub23 — university students
- Social Pass — for eligible households
4. Where to load the Navegante Pass
- Metro ticket machines
- CP ticket offices
- Authorised Viva kiosks
Pass is valid for a calendar month.
5. Practical examples
Live and work in Lisbon
- Best option: Navegante Municipal Lisboa
Live in Sintra, work in Lisbon
- Best option: Navegante Metropolitano
Live in Cascais/Oeiras, work in Lisbon
- Best option: Navegante Metropolitano
